Job Description
Vitality Living is seeking a dynamic, compassionate leader of people to oversee Health and Wellness efforts for one of the area's best senior living communities. This critical leadership role will champion resident rights and ensure that medical, emotional, physical, and spiritual needs are being met. The Director of Wellness Transitions and Compliance serves as project lead for wellness transitions for newly acquired communities including data conversion and validation, end user training, set up of clinical system of record, and hand off to regional support team as well as monitors clinical compliance across the portfolio. As a Vitality Director of Wellness Transitions and Compliance, you will: Serve as a clinical representative on the transitions team to support the onboarding of new communities. Coordinate all phases of the wellness transition with community team members. Complete analysis of current community practices, set expectations to comply with state regulations, and complete transition items within established timeline. Quickly establish relationships with newly onboarding community teams. Train newly onboarded community teams on Vitality wellness standards. Track and coordinate training for new wellness team members, including completing on-boarding checklists and conducting follow-up calls for support as needed. Maintain, track, and assist with updating company policies. Track and trend regulatory citations by state and provide analysis to wellness and operations teams. Analyze key wellness KPI's and update wellness team on trends identified. Provide supporting information, interpretations, clarifications, and advice to regional and senior leadership to assist in making informed data-driven decisions. Complete focused compliance and standards visits for communities with an identified need. Perform other duties as assigned
Skills and Qualifications:
Valid, unencumbered LPN, LVN or RN license or compact license. Proficiency in Microsoft Office products and other programs as required. Excellent written and verbal communication skills. Strong attention to detail and follow-through. Effective training abilities, excellent leadership and people skills. Dedication to teamwork and long-term commitment to success. Analytical thinker with strong conceptual problem-solving skills. Attention to detail with ability to multi-task. Ability to work independently and as part of a team. Excellent documentation, organizational, communication, and IT skills. Strong problem-solving skills Ability to work comfortably under tight deadlines and pressure Ability to travel up to 75%.
